Skip to main content
È disponibile una versione più recente di questo prodotto.
La versione in lingua italiana fornita proviene da una traduzione automatica. Per eventuali incoerenze, fare riferimento alla versione in lingua inglese.

API REST di disaster recovery (DR)

Collaboratori

La funzionalità di disaster recovery (DR) di SnapCenter utilizza API REST per il backup del server SnapCenter. Prima di utilizzare le API REST di DR, eseguire le seguenti operazioni.

Fasi

  1. Creare un nuovo backup DR del server, che ripristini un server SnapCenter da un backup DR del server specificato utilizzando l'API REST del backup DR: /4.5/disasterrecovery/server/backup

  2. Avviare il computer server secondario, ma prima di installare il server SnapCenter sul server secondario è necessario completare i prerequisiti.

    • Il nome host/host FQDN del server alternativo deve essere uguale al nome host del server primario, ma l'indirizzo IP può essere diverso.

    • La versione del server secondario deve essere la stessa del server primario.

    • Il SnapCenter secondario deve essere installato nella stessa posizione e sulla stessa porta del server primario.

  3. Prima di attivare l'operazione di ripristino DR del server, è necessario visualizzare il percorso di destinazione o il percorso in cui vengono memorizzati i backup DR dopo il disastro.

    • Assicurarsi che i file di backup del DR vengano copiati nel nuovo server SnapCenter utilizzando il seguente comando: xcopy <Ssource_Path> \\<Destination_Server_IP>\<Folder_Path> /O /X /E /H /K {ex : xcopy C:\DRBackup \\10.225.81.114\c$\DRBackup /O /X /E /H /K}

  4. Installare il server SnapCenter sul computer secondario.

    • Durante l'esecuzione dell'operazione di ripristino DR, assicurarsi che non siano in esecuzione processi relativi al server SnapCenter.

  5. Installare il server SnapCenter secondario nella stessa posizione e sulla stessa porta del server primario.

    • Eseguire l'operazione di ripristino DR del server utilizzando l'API di ripristino DR: /4.5/disasterrecovery/server/restore

      Se il plug-in non è in grado di risolvere il nome host del server, accedere a ciascuno degli host del plug-in e aggiungere la voce etc/host per il nuovo IP nel formato nome_server_SC_<New IP>. Ad esempio, 10.225.81.35 SCServer1

    Le voci del server etc/host non verranno ripristinate. È possibile ripristinarlo manualmente dalla cartella di backup del DR.

Nota Per un'installazione F5, l'operazione di ripristino viene eseguita come standalone; è necessario eseguire una serie di comandi per creare di nuovo F5. Vedere, collegamento: "Come migrare SnapCenter su un altro server"
Nota Dopo il ripristino di DR, l'host viene aggiunto, ma è necessario installare il plug-in manualmente.
Nota La pianificazione del backup del repository verrà ripristinata solo se si installa il plug-in SnapCenter per Windows e si collega il LUN NetApp alla macchina server.
Nota Se le DLL sono corrotte, provare a riparare il server SnapCenter o a correggere l'installazione errata.
Nota Se i file NSM o di configurazione sono corrotti, è possibile disinstallare e reinstallare il server SnapCenter con la stessa versione.
Nota Se la macchina virtuale è danneggiata, avviare un'altra macchina virtuale o un computer con lo stesso nome e installare il server SnapCenter con la stessa versione.

API REST supportata per il disaster recovery del server SnapCenter

Utilizzando le API REST, è possibile eseguire le seguenti operazioni nella pagina REST API Swagger. Per informazioni su come accedere alla pagina Swagger, vedere "Come accedere alle API REST utilizzando la pagina web delle API di swagger".

Prima di iniziare
  • Accedere come utente amministratore di SnapCenter.

  • Il server SnapCenter deve essere attivo e in esecuzione per eseguire l'API di ripristino DR.

  • Se le DLL sono danneggiate, riparare l'installazione del server SnapCenter.

  • Se NSM è danneggiato o i file di configurazione sono danneggiati, disinstallare e reinstallare il server SnapCenter con la stessa versione.

  • Se la VM è danneggiata, richiamare un'altra VM con lo stesso nome e installare il server SnapCenter con la stessa versione.

A proposito di questa attività

Il DR del server SnapCenter supporta tutti i plug-in.

Descrizione API REST Metodo HTTP

Recuperare i backup DR del server SnapCenter esistenti

Specificare il percorso di destinazione in cui sono memorizzati i backup di DR.

/4.5/disasterrecovery/server/backup?targetpath={path}

OTTIENI

Creare un nuovo backup DR del server.

/4.5/disasterrecovery/server/backup

POST

Ripristina un server SnapCenter da un backup DR del server specificato.

/4.5/disasterrecovery/server/restore

POST

Eliminare il backup DR del server in base al nome del backup.

/4.5/disasterrecovery/server/backup

ELIMINARE

Attivare o disattivare il DR dello storage

/4.5/disasterrecovery/storage

POST

Informazioni correlate

Vedere "API di disaster recovery" video.